1. Install "golang-google-api-devel.noarch" package

This tutorial shows how to install golang-google-api-devel.noarch on Fedora 34

$ sudo dnf update $ sudo dnf install golang-google-api-devel.noarch

2. Uninstall "golang-google-api-devel.noarch" package

Please follow the step by step instructions below to uninstall golang-google-api-devel.noarch on Fedora 34:

$ sudo dnf remove golang-google-api-devel.noarch $ sudo dnf autoremove

3. Information about the golang-google-api-devel.noarch package on Fedora 34

Last metadata expiration check: 3:42:05 ago on Tue Sep 6 08:10:37 2022.
Available Packages
Name : golang-google-api-devel
Version : 0.64.0
Release : 1.fc34
Architecture : noarch
Size : 5.0 M
Source : golang-google-api-0.64.0-1.fc34.src.rpm
Repository : updates
Summary : Auto-generated Google apis for Go
URL : https://github.com/google/google-api-go-client
License : MIT and BSD
Description : These are auto-generated Go libraries from the Google Discovery Service's JSON
: description files of the available "new style" Google APIs.
:
: Due to the auto-generated nature of this collection of libraries, complete APIs
: or specific versions can appear or go away without notice. As a result, you
: should always locally vendor any API(s) that your code relies upon.
:
: These client libraries are officially supported by Google. However, the
: libraries are considered complete and are in maintenance mode. This means that
: we will address critical bugs and security issues but will not add any new
: features.
:
: This package contains the source code needed for building packages that
: reference the following Go import paths:
: – google.golang.org/api
